
Google’s Carbon Emissions Jump by 48% Since 2019: The Impact of AI on the Environment
In its latest environmental report, Google has revealed that its carbon emissions have increased by a staggering 48% since 2019. The report, which was released in 2025, also highlighted a 13% jump in carbon emissions in 2024 alone. This significant increase has raised concerns about the environmental impact of the tech giant’s operations, particularly in the context of its growing reliance on artificial intelligence (AI).
According to the report, the main drivers of this increase in carbon emissions are the growing demand for data centers and the associated “supply chain emissions”. Data centers now represent 25% of Google’s total energy consumption, which is a significant portion of its overall energy usage.

To mitigate the environmental impact of its operations, Google has committed to powering 100% of its operations with renewable energy by 2025. This goal is part of the company’s broader sustainability strategy, which aims to reduce its carbon footprint and promote sustainability in its operations and supply chain.
The company is also exploring new technologies and innovations that can help reduce its environmental impact. For example, Google is working on developing more energy-efficient data centers and exploring the use of artificial intelligence to optimize energy usage.
In addition to these efforts, Google is also partnering with other companies and organizations to promote sustainability and reduce carbon emissions. The company is a member of the Renewable Energy Buyers Alliance, which aims to promote the adoption of renewable energy in the tech industry.
The environmental report also highlights Google’s efforts to reduce waste and increase recycling in its operations. The company has set a goal of reducing its waste by 50% by 2025, and is working to increase recycling rates and reduce the amount of electronic waste generated by its operations.
